MURIC Asks Fayose To Fulfil His Promise Of Committing Suicide If Buhari Returns

Following the return of President Muhammadu Buhari to the country yesterday after his 103 days of medical vacation, Professor Ishaq Akintola, President, Muslim Rights Concern (MURIC) has asked the Governor of Ekiti State, Mr. Ayodele Fayose, an avid critic of the ruling All Progressives Congress, to fulfil his promise to commit suicide if President Buhari who he has said on different occasions that the president is either dead or incapacitated.

“It is quite germane at this juncture to remind Nigerians that Governor Ayo Fayose of Ekiti State allegedly promised to commit suicide if Buhari returns to Nigeria alive. Well, the president is back and Nigerians owe it a duty to ask whether or not Fayose would redeem his pledge. Is Fayose a man of his words? Will Fayose commit suicide? Will he be man enough to do just that? Fayose is an interesting study in political fanaticism and executive exuberance. The garrulous self-confessed danfo conductor just pushed his luck too far this time around. We are constrained to ask, “Where is Fayose’s integrity?”

In the statement made available to BlackBox Nigeria, the Muslim Rights Concern (MURIC) welcomed the president and called those asking him to resume or resign heartless.

“We recall the #ResumeorResign and #OurMumuDonDo protests staged in Abuja and London against the continued absence of Buhari. Those protesters manifested heartlessness, pettiness and the inhumanity of man to man. There was no reasonable casus belli for protests when no law has been broken and there was no palpable lacuna in the presidency. How can you protest against a man for seeking medical attention? It is the height of wickedness, ” the statement reads.

The group also showered encomiums on Vice President Yemi Osinbajo for demonstrating faith in Project Nigeria, exhibiting strong character and manifested self-satisfaction cum exemplary statesmanship while acting as president.
